RITA Ora will be forced to quarantine for two weeks after flying to Australia to appear on their version of talent show The Voice.
The British singer has been under fire over her controversial 30th birthday party, which was held at a restaurant in West London despite the Covid lockdown rules banning gatherings and forcing hospitality venues to close.
And she is now set to leave the country next month to head down under for an extended stay to work on the singing contest – but will first be required to stay locked in her hotel room for a fortnight in line with the country’s strict travel rules.
A small number of A-listers including Tom Hanks and Matt Damon are understood to have been given exemptions from the rules to allow them to travel.
